This report analyzed 5 schools in Michigan to see which ones offered the best value graduate certificate programs for English or French students. The goal was to highlight schools with more affordable prices than others offering similar quality experiences.

Our ranking of value is based on the quality of a program as defined in our per sticker price dollar.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.

In our regional and nationwide rankings, out-of-state tution and fees are used in our calculations.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.

Our 2023 rankings named Northern Michigan University the best value school in Michigan for teaching English or French students working on their graduate certificate. Located in the remote town of Marquette, Northern Michigan University is a public school with a medium-sized student population.

The average tuition and fees for an in-state graduate student at Northern Michigan University are $10,612 a year.
